Optimal Absorption and Stomach Sensitivity
Here are some practical aspects to consider regarding zinc absorption and stomach sensitivity:
- Empty Stomach: The reference suggests that taking zinc on an empty stomach will promote optimal absorption.
- Stomach Upset: Some people may experience stomach discomfort when taking zinc on an empty stomach. If this happens, consider taking it with food.
- Finding What Works: Experiment with taking zinc at different times to find what is most comfortable for your body.
